PROMOTING THE ROLE OF TEACHER ULRS
A guide to promote the role of teacher ULRs has been produced by a working partnership between ATL, NASUWT, NUT, Bracknell Forest Borough Council, Brighton and Hove City Council, Oxfordshire County Council, Labour Research Department and SERTUC Learning Services. The project was funded by the Trade Union Fund for the South East (TUFSE).
The guide is aimed at local authorities, governing bodies, head teachers and other employers of teachers. It aims to increase understanding of and support for the role of the teacher ULR.
